Identifying Common Vulnerabilities in New Online Casino Platforms

Analyzing Recent Security Breach Case Studies

Understanding past security breaches offers invaluable lessons for new casino operators. For example, a notable case involved a European online casino that suffered a data breach exposing sensitive customer information. The breach stemmed from weak server configuration and outdated software, illustrating the importance of maintaining current security patches. According to reports from cybersecurity firms, over 70% of cyber attacks target known vulnerabilities that could be avoided with timely updates.

Another case involved a casino platform that experienced a significant financial fraud incident. Investigations revealed exploitation of insufficient input validation, which allowed malicious actors to manipulate web forms and siphon funds. These incidents underscore the necessity for comprehensive security analyses before and after launch to identify potential weak points.

Recognizing Weaknesses in User Authentication Protocols

Authentication processes are critical in preventing unauthorized access. Many recent casino websites have weaknesses such as reliance on simple passwords, absence of multi-factor authentication (MFA), or insecure session management. For instance, a rising trend has been the use of weak security questions, which can be easily guessed or bypassed through social engineering.

Studies indicate that 81% of breaches involve compromised passwords, emphasizing the importance of implementing robust authentication protocols. Multi-factor authentication, biometric verification, and adaptive login solutions significantly reduce the risk of account hijacking. Regular audits to test authentication systems for vulnerabilities are essential for early detection of weaknesses.

Spotting Flaws in Payment Processing and Data Encryption

Financial transactions are prime targets for cybercriminals. Recent breaches have exploited flaws such as poor encryption standards and insecure payment gateways. For example, some newly launched casinos have experienced data leaks due to outdated SSL/TLS protocols, which can be easily decrypted by attackers.

Additionally, vulnerabilities in payment processing systems—like inadequate PCI DSS compliance—can lead to data breaches and financial fraud. Implementing end-to-end encryption, tokenization, and secure payment gateways have become standard best practices to safeguard user data and ensure compliance with industry regulations.

Implementing Proactive Security Assessment Techniques for New Casinos

Conducting Regular Penetration Testing and Vulnerability Scanning

Routine penetration testing simulates real-world attacks to identify exploitable vulnerabilities. For example, a casino testing its platform discovered a SQL injection flaw that could have allowed data extraction. Using certified security professionals, operators can assess their systems’ resilience and remediate weaknesses before malicious actors do.

Vulnerability scanning tools, such as Nessus or Qualys, enable continuous monitoring for known threats and misconfigurations. The National Institute of Standards and Technology (NIST) recommends integrating these assessments into the development cycle to ensure security is maintained as the platform evolves.

Utilizing Automated Security Monitoring Tools

Automation enhances the ability to detect anomalies and potential intrusions promptly. Implementing Security Information and Event Management (SIEM) systems, like Splunk or IBM QRadar, allows real-time analysis of logs and alerts operators of suspicious activities. For instance, sudden login spikes from unusual geographic locations could indicate credential stuffing attacks, enabling swift responses.

Automated tools reduce human error, streamline security workflows, and provide continuous oversight essential for quickly identifying emerging threats.

Integrating Threat Detection Systems During Development

Embedding threat detection mechanisms during the development phase ensures security is built-in from the outset. Covering areas like abnormal behavior detection, malware scanning, and code analysis helps identify flaws early. Static Application Security Testing (SAST) and Dynamic Application Security Testing (DAST) tools can identify insecure coding practices in real-time, preventing exploitable vulnerabilities from reaching production.

For example, integrating SAST tools such as Checkmarx or Veracode into CI/CD pipelines facilitates automated security checks that catch weaknesses before deployment, avoiding costly fixes later.

Leveraging Industry Standards and Best Practices to Reinforce Security

Adhering to PCI DSS and ISO 27001 Compliance

Compliance with industry standards like PCI DSS (Payment Card Industry Data Security Standard) ensures that payment transactions are handled securely. PCI DSS mandates encryption, access controls, and regular vulnerability assessments. A survey by the PCI Security Standards Council highlights that compliant organizations are 50% less likely to experience data breaches. Similarly, ISO 27001 provides a comprehensive framework for establishing an Information Security Management System (ISMS), which guides organizations in managing sensitive information systematically. An ISO-certified casino demonstrates a commitment to security that can enhance customer confidence and satisfy regulatory requirements.

Applying Secure Coding Standards in Casino Software Development

Secure coding practices are fundamental to minimizing vulnerabilities. Industry standards such as OWASP Top Ten emphasize avoiding common issues like buffer overflows, injection flaws, and insecure data handling. For example, input validation and parameterized queries can prevent SQL injection attacks, which are still prevalent in poorly coded applications.

Implementing code reviews, static analysis, and security training for developers ensures adherence to secure coding standards. This layered approach reduces the likelihood of introducing vulnerabilities during software development.

Establishing Robust Incident Response and Recovery Plans

“A well-prepared incident response plan enables a casino to respond swiftly to security breaches, minimizing damage and restoring service efficiently.”

Creating and regularly updating incident response plans (IRPs) is vital. Effective IRPs define roles, communication channels, and recovery procedures. For instance, a recent incident at a new online casino was contained within hours, thanks to a predefined IRP, preventing extended service disruption and data loss.

Regular testing of IRPs through simulated attacks, coupled with backup and disaster recovery strategies, ensures resilience against evolving security threats.
